The curing oven is another type of industrial oven that can be used to bond powder coatings onto metal surfaces, and speed up the drying process. It is also able to make products from rubber, plastic and other non-metallic materials. Industrial ovens for curing are powered by electricity, steam or UV light.
Conveyor ovens on the other hand, are powered by propane or natural gas. They can come with flat conveyor chains, belts Ferris wheels, carousels, serpentine designs, or overhead trolleys to convey products through the oven. They can operate at lower temperatures than batch ovens, and allow for continuous or indexed feed through heat zones, reducing energy and labor costs.
Easy cleaning
Keeping an oven clean isn't easy because of the heavy build-up of food residue and grease that can accumulate over time. To speed up the time to clean the oven, it is crucial to adhere to an ongoing schedule of cleaning. However, if you're not sure where to start there are a variety of oven cleaning hacks that can help.
Before you begin cleaning the oven, ensure it's completely cool and empty. Mix baking soda and water to create an emulsion. Spread the paste over the interior surfaces of the oven and allow it to sit overnight. The chemical reaction between the baking soda and vinegar aids to loosen debris so that it can be easily wiped away.
If the issue is particularly difficult, use an iron scraper and a paint scraper to remove as much of the carbon and dirt as is possible. You can also use a caustic cleaner spray or a bio-friendly paste, but they may not be strong and effective enough to eliminate the most stubborn grease or burnt on food items. If you decide to use a caustic solution, try Easy Off that is not flammable.
White vinegar is a safe option that you can use if you want to avoid harsh chemicals. Fill a sprayer with the solution and spray it across the interior of your stove. Once the surface is cleaned, wipe it clean with a damp sponge or microfiber cloth. Repeat until all grease and grime is gone. You should also wipe down the handles, knobs and other parts of the oven that are frequently touched. You can also make use of a scrubbing tool to scrub the toughest areas of your oven.
